The examined visuals show a set including a portable handheld device used for medical diagnosis and its related accessories. The product is an otoscope device, presented in a storage box, consisting of a head and body, used for ear examinations.
As a result of detailed examinations on the product, its box, and the user manual, the brand and model information has been definitively identified:
This information can be clearly read on the device’s head with the inscription “HEINE mini 2000 CE”, on the carrying clip with the “HEINE” print, and on the accompanying original user manual. The manual clearly indicates that “HEINE OPTOTECHNIK” is a German company and its address is visible.
The product’s craftsmanship, plastic molding quality, clarity of its logos, font characters, and compliance of the “CE” markings with standards indicate that the device is a 100% genuine HEINE product. Furthermore, the presence of the set with its brand-specific gray plastic molded carrying case and technical documents supports its authenticity.
The HEINE mini 2000 otoscope is primarily used by medical doctors, family physicians, pediatricians, and ear, nose, and throat (ENT) specialists. The main purpose of the device is to illuminate and examine the external auditory canal and the eardrum (tympanic membrane). Due to its portable nature, it is suitable for use in polyclinic environments, emergency services, and home healthcare services.
